Mines Near Coaldale borough (Schuylkill County), PA

4 mining sites from the Mine Safety and Health Administration (MSHA) found near Coaldale borough (Schuylkill County), PA.

Name Description
#12 Fine Coal Plant Coal (Anthracite) - Facility (Abandoned)
Bethlehem Mine Coal (Anthracite) - Facility (Abandoned)
M & J #7 Bank Coal (Anthracite) - Facility (Abandoned)
NEPCO Coal (Anthracite) - Surface (Abandoned)
